JUNO BEACH, Fla., Jan. 27, 2017 /PRNewswire/ -- Mild Florida winters normally bring an opportunity to don a favorite sweater or open windows to enjoy the crisp air. When a cold snap hits, what comes as a surprise to many is that heating your home costs more than cooling it.
With cooler weather expected to enter our state, Florida Power & Light Company (FPL) encourages customers to take control of their energy usage this winter and save money with these helpful tips.
"Because extreme cold weather is so rare in Florida, many heating systems aren't built to work efficiently – they require more energy to operate, which translates to higher costs," said FPL Energy Expert Tiffany Spence. "We know that every dollar customers can save helps. By taking small steps to use energy wisely this winter, they can make their bills even lower."

About Florida Power & Light Company
Florida Power & Light Company is the third-largest electric utility in the United States, serving more than 4.8 million customer accounts or more than 10 million people across nearly half of the state of Florida. FPL's typical 1,000-kWh residential customer bill is approximately 30 percent lower than the latest national average and, in 2015, was the lowest in Florida among reporting utilities for the sixth year in a row. FPL's service reliability is better than 99.98 percent, and its highly fuel-efficient power plant fleet is one of the cleanest among all utilities nationwide. The company received the top ranking in the southern U.S. among large electric providers, according to the J.D. Power 2016 Electric Utility Residential Customer Satisfaction StudySM, and was recognized in 2016 as one of the most trusted U.S. electric utilities by Market Strategies International. A leading Florida employer with approximately 8,800 employees, FPL is a subsidiary of Juno Beach, Fla.-based NextEra Energy, Inc. (NYSE: NEE), a clean energy company widely recognized for its efforts in sustainability, ethics and diversity, and has been ranked No. 1 in the electric and gas utilities industry in Fortune's 2016 list of "World's Most Admired Companies." NextEra Energy is also the parent company of NextEra Energy Resources, LLC, which, together with its affiliated entities, is the world's largest generator of renewable energy from the wind and sun.
